BMW 528xi prices: common questions

How much does a BMW 528xi cost?

As of September 9, 2026, the typical asking price for a 2013 BMW 528xi is $8,500, based on 91 active dealer listings. Across every model year we can price (2012–2013 and 2008) we track 160 active listings.

Why do the BMW 528xi model years jump from 2008 to 2012–2013?

No qualifying BMW 528xi price data are available for the 2009–2011 model years. Years before the gap are priced separately below. A gap in available price data alone does not establish a generation change.

Which BMW 528xi model year is cheapest?

The 2008 model year has the lowest typical asking price we track at $6,850 — it appears before a gap in available price data. Within the newest available run (2012–2013), the cheapest is the 2013 at $8,500. These are asking prices, not condition-adjusted values — an older year with high mileage can still cost more to own than a newer one.

Do older BMW 528xi years always cost less?

Not always. 1 of the 2 older model years we can price ask less than the 2013; the remaining 1 ask more, topping out at $8,945 for the 2012. Note: No qualifying BMW 528xi price data are available for the 2009–2011 model years — a gap in price data does not establish a generation change. Differences in asking prices can reflect mileage, condition and configuration.

How current are these prices?

They come from 160 listings that were active on dealer sites when we last refreshed this page, September 9, 2026. We exclude the top and bottom 2% of prices to reduce the influence of extreme values. This does not verify vehicle condition. These are dealer asking prices, not final sale prices, and exclude taxes and fees.
